要約:The Fideos Noelia company, dedicated to the production of pasta and noodles in Babahoyo, faces a crucial challenge in the management of accounts receivable that directly impacts its liquidity and ability to meet financial obligations. The problem lies in the lack of adequate control, which affects the company's ability to maintain its liquidity, especially during the 2022 accounting period. Inefficient accounts receivable management not only affects the cash conversion cycle but also the effectiveness of the collections and credit process. The absence of clear policies and adequate monitoring makes timely recovery of payments difficult, generating a negative impact on working capital and, ultimately, the financial stability of the company. The correct valuation of accounts receivable is vital for the financial health of the company, avoiding risks that could compromise its stability. The implementation of efficient mechanisms will allow Noelia to optimize its liquidity, meet financial commitments and ensure its sustainability in the market.
